What is a counselling psychologist?

Counselling psychologists are psychologists who combine psychological research and theory with therapeutic approaches to work with individuals, families and other different groups of people.

What does a counselling psychologist do?

Counselling psychologists can take on a number of tasks. These can include conducting psychological testing, formulation of mental health problems, therapy, research and development, teaching and supervision amongst others.

What is the difference between a psychiatrist and a psychologist?

A psychiatrist is a medical doctor and psychiatry is a specialist field in medicine. As medical doctors, psychiatrists prescribe medicine for mental health problems.

A psychologist is a scientist but not a medical doctor. A psychologist is unable to prescribe medicine to treat mental health problems. A psychologist uses his / her training in the areas of psychological health and human conduct and behavior to treat mental health problems.

Some psychologists do use the title ‘Doctor’ because they have a doctoral degree in psychology. This doctoral degree may be a Ph.D or more commonly a Psy.D.

Are psychologists in Singapore regulated?

Currently in Singapore, there is no regulation of psychologists. In choosing a psychologist, you may therefore want to check whether the psychologist is accredited or a member with any professional body such as the British Psychological Society, American Psychological Association or Singapore Psychological Society for example.

Will what I say be treated as confidential?

The general rule is that what you say will be treated as confidential. A psychologist for example, cannot discuss your treatment with anyone else without your consent.

There are however certain exceptions to confidentiality. Under most codes of ethics, psychologists are under a duty to disclose certain types of information to others e.g. if a client threatens to hurt himself or to hurt others, the psychologist may have to inform someone. As there are several exceptions to confidentiality, your psychologist will be discussing these with you.

What is CBT ?

CBT (Cognitive Behaviour Therapy) is evidence-based treatment especially helpful for anxiety and depression. Its main premise is that the way we think, affects our behaviours and our feelings. For example, if we are feeling anxious, it may be because we had these thoughts ‘’What if something goes wrong today?’’ or ‘’What if I say the wrong thing?’’.

CBT will help to address these worries and to challenge the assumptions that underlie the fear. Helpful psychological techniques will be shared during the sessions to address these worries. Handouts and some homework may be given to clients.

What is Psychodynamic Therapy?

Psychodynamic therapy is a form of talking therapy. It is less structured and directive compared to CBT and will suit a client who wishes to be more reflective and who may wish to explore the root causes of their issues.

There is also space here for clients to talk about their dreams if they so wish to. This form of therapy is suitable for individuals who are curious about themselves and their private thoughts and who would like to explore issues in greater depth.
